Choosing the right M.Tech specialization in Printing and Media Technology is crucial. Here's a comparison to guide you:
Specialization | Focus | Career Paths | Key Skills |
---|---|---|---|
Print Production Management | Optimizing print processes, quality control, workflow. | Print Manager, Production Supervisor, Quality Control Specialist. | Process optimization, quality assurance, leadership. |
Digital Printing and Imaging | Digital printing techniques, color management, image processing. | Digital Print Specialist, Graphic Designer, Pre-press Technician. | Digital printing, color correction, image manipulation. |
Packaging Technology | Packaging design, material science, testing. | Packaging Designer, Packaging Engineer, Quality Assurance Manager (Packaging). | Material science, design principles, testing methodologies. |
Media Technology & Communication | Integrating print with digital media, cross-media publishing. | Media Technologist, Cross-Media Publisher, Digital Marketing Specialist (Print Focus). | Digital media integration, content management, marketing strategies. |
Consider your interests and career aspirations when making your choice. Each specialization offers unique opportunities within the printing and media landscape. Researching industry trends and job market demands can further refine your decision.

An M.Tech in Printing and Media Technology opens doors to diverse and well-compensated career paths in India. Salary trends are influenced by factors like experience, skills, specialization, and location. Entry-level professionals can expect an average annual salary ranging from ₹3.5 LPA to ₹6 LPA. With 3-5 years of experience, this can rise to ₹6 LPA to ₹10 LPA. Senior professionals with over 10 years of experience and specialized skills can command salaries exceeding ₹12 LPA to ₹20 LPA or more.
